The Gregori Jaguars lost to the Enochs Eagles back in January, but the Gregori Jaguars didn't allow the Enochs Eagles the same satisfaction on Friday. Gregori snuck past the Eagles with a 56-52 win.
Gregori found their leader in underclassman Jayson Powers, who almost dropped a double-double on 17 points and nine rebounds. Powers is on a roll when it comes to points, as he's now scored 17 or more in the last three games he's played. Raphael Rosas was another key contributor, scoring ten points along with six rebounds and two steals.
Gregori's victory ended a three-game drought at home and bumped them up to 13-13. As for Enochs, they have traveled a rocky road recently having lost three of their last four matchups, which put a noticeable dent in their 11-15 record this season.
